Job description
Company Overview

Our client is a global leader in high-performance paints and coatings, recognized for protecting iconic landmarks across the world. They foster a unique "people-first" culture that values loyalty and innovation.

Job Responsibilities
  • R&D & Optimization: Develop and refine formulations to improve cost-efficiency and product performance.
  • Quality & Compliance: Oversee raw material testing and lab instrument calibration in line with company's HSEQ and international standards.
  • Operational Excellence: Streamline color-matching cycles and provide technical support to production and maintenance teams.
  • Collaboration: Act as a bridge between Lab, QC, Sales, and Purchasing to ensure seamless product delivery and inventory management.
  • Leadership: Mentor junior chemists and manage lab planning to meet lead-time targets and KPIs.
Qualifications
  • A Degree in Chemistry or Chemical Engineering.
  • Minimum 4 years of specialized experience in Powder Coatings.
  • A methodical problem-solver with strong leadership potential.
